6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define natural numbers.

Back

Natural numbers are the set of positive integers starting from 1 (1, 2, 3, ...).

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the difference between whole numbers and integers?

Back

Whole numbers include all natural numbers and zero (0, 1, 2, 3, ...), while integers include all whole numbers and their negative counterparts (..., -3, -2, -1, 0, 1, 2, 3, ...).
